Liverpool manager Arne Slot held a press conference ahead of Saturday’s Premier League match against Fulham. He was asked to look ahead to the Champions League quarter-final second leg against Paris Saint-Germain. Despite the 2-0 first-leg defeat, he emphasized his ambition and confidence.
Slot said, “We can show that we are much more competitive.”
“If there’s one positive takeaway from this match against PSG, it’s that we faced the European champions and we weren’t at our best that night, but in four or five days, we can show that we’re much more competitive. It also shows us that if we want to continue to progress, we have to play at this level in the Champions League.
We want to participate next season to show that we can do even better in this competition, and to do that, we need to improve in the league. Not all of our players are capable of playing another intense match in a few days, so let’s see what the lineup holds for us,” these comments were reported by Foot Mercato.
